 The Ultra bottle, which is available exclusively at Babies R Us, delivers a natural breast-like latch and a perfectly secure seal and angled position for a continuous milk flow resulting in a perfect feeding experience.

The Ultra bottle’s premium features include:

 • Easy Transitions: The extra wide nipple on the Ultra bottle offers a more breast-like shape for baby to latch onto. The nipple is made from a super-soft, high grade silicone, which allows the nipple to move in multiple directions like a breast, replicating a natural feeding action. The breast-like nature of this bottle makes for easier transitions between breast and bottle. 

  • Anti-Colic: A contour zone has been uniquely built into the Ultra nipple, which forms a perfect match to baby’s open mouth. This zone allows baby to form a secure seal around the nipple, which helps reduce air intake and discomfort. It also helps prevent messy milk dribbles for a more comfortable feed. 

  • Smooth Milk Flow: The innovative angled nipple on the Ultra bottle provides a more comfortable, upright feeding position for baby. Milk flows down the bottle in an even way ensuring the nipple stays full of milk throughout the feed. 

 The full range of BPA-free products is available exclusively at Babies “R” Us. The Ultra bottles are available in 5 oz. and 9 oz. sizes, and prices range from $10.99 for a single pack to $26.99 for a 3-pack. For more information, please visit tommeetippee.us.  Below are some tips and techniques to hone your sandwich craft – essentially, the three “Bs” of the perfect grilled cheese:

Base — Like most iconic sandwich makers across the country would say, the bread you choose will make or break your masterpiece. Sara Lee’s new Artesano style bread is the perfect canvas for your grilled cheese creation. The hearty Italian slices will hold strong under the weight of the gooey cheese, but won’t overpower your fillings. It also crisps nicely on the outside, while the inside remains soft and fluffy for when you dig in.

Butter — If you’ve already committed to indulging in directly on the outside of the bread, rather than melting it in the pan first. This allows every corner of your Artesano bread to be coated, allowing for an even, golden sear edge- to-edge.

Blend — What you put inside your grilled cheese matters, and not all cheeses are created equal. Are you looking for a spicy, savory blend? Or how about a sweet and tangy? Whatever the combo, remember your cheese and other fillings need to play together nicely in the sandbox. Pick ingredients that pair well for that perfect balance on your palate.

Turkey Breakfast Sausage Chilaquiles

 

Serves 8

Prep time 20 mins

Total time under 30 mins

 

Ingredients

 

SAUCE

 

2 (14.5-ounce) cans diced fire roasted tomatoes

1 cup chopped onion

1 roasted red bell pepper

1 cup fat-free low-sodium chicken broth

¼ cup chopped cilantro

1 tablespoon fresh lime juice

2 teaspoons chopped garlic

½ teaspoon chili powder

½ teaspoon ground mustard

½ teaspoon dried oregano

½ teaspoon ground cumin

1 tablespoon chipotle chili in adobo sauce, if desired

salt and pepper, if desired

 

CHILAQUILES

1 (16-ounce) package JENNIE-O® Lean Mild Turkey Breakfast Sausage Roll

48 baked corn tortilla strips

½ cup thinly sliced red onion

¼ cup crumbled low-fat feta cheese

¼ cup chopped fresh cilantro

1 medium avocado, died or ½ cup guacamole, if desired

 

DIRECTIONS:

Sauce:

In bowl of food processor or jar of a blender purée all sauce ingredients until smooth. Pour into a 2 quart sauté pan, simmer sauce, stirring, 3 minutes and season with salt and pepper, if desired. Keep warm. (Sauce may be made 2 days ahead and chilled, covered.) Yield 6 cups.

 

Chilaquiles:  

Cook turkey sausage as specified on the package. Always cook to well-done, 165°F as measured by a meat thermometer. Set aside.

Assemble Chilaquiles in shallow dishes or soup bowls. Crumble 6 tortilla chips into each bowl. Top with ¾ cup very hot sauce. Sprinkle with ¼ cup turkey sausage crumbles. Garnish with onion, feta cheese, cilantro and avocado, if desired.
